概括
一种常见的口腔细菌Streptococcus mitis,即使在健康的儿童中,也可能导致严重的侵入性感染,如脑膜炎和脑中静脉血栓症. 这凸显了口腔卫生的重要性,以及由于新出现的耐药性,谨慎选择抗生素.

背景情况:
- 杆菌菌 (S. mitis) 是维里达斯群杆菌 (VGS) 的一种,通常在口腔中发现.
- 虽然通常被认为在免疫能力较强的人群中具有较低的致病性,但S. mitis可以引起侵袭性疾病,特别是在免疫功能低下的患者中.
研究的目的:
- 研究S.mitis在侵袭性感染中的病原性作用.
- 审查有关儿科患者侵袭性S. mitis疾病的文献.
- 突出口腔健康状况在侵袭性感染中的重要性.
主要方法:
- 一个以前健康的12岁男孩患有鼻炎,脑膜炎和由S. mitis引起的脑中静脉血栓 (CSVT) 的病例报告.
- 关于儿童群体侵入性S. mitis感染的广泛文献综述.
主要成果:
- 在免疫能力较强的儿童中,S. mitis可以引起严重的侵入性感染,包括脑膜炎和CSVT.
- 糟糕的口腔健康状况 (例如,鼻炎,) 可能是侵入性S. mitis感染的诱导因素.
- 在VGS中出现的抗菌素耐药性模式需要仔细考虑治疗选择.
结论:
- S.mitis在侵袭性感染中起着至关重要的作用,即使在具有易感性疾病的免疫能力强的儿童中也是如此.
- 保持良好的口腔卫生对于预防侵入性细菌感染至关重要.
- 对VGS抗微生物耐药性的认识对于有效的治疗策略至关重要.

Bacterial Phylum Tenericutes
42
The phylum Tenericutes, which includes the single class Mollicutes, comprises bacteria that lack cell walls. The term "Mollicutes" derives from the Latin word mollis, meaning "soft." These organisms are among the smallest known and are commonly referred to as mycoplasmas due to the prominence of the genus Mycoplasma, which includes well-known human pathogens.
